Rules For Registration, Who Can Open An Account, And Verification

If you want to open a LeoVegas account, you need to fill out the registration form correctly and keep your information up to date. You should be the only one who makes an account, and all players should give accurate information about themselves that matches what's on their IDs. The casino may not let you into your account until the information is fixed if some details are not correct. Accounts can only be opened by players who are at least the legal age in their country and are allowed to play from that country. There should only be one account per customer at LeoVegas.

Multiple registrations, shared accounts, or attempts to make accounts for other people can get your account closed or rejected. The review process could hold any funds linked to an account that isn't eligible or that has been used more than once. Checks for identity LeoVegas may ask for proof of identity before letting you withdraw money, or they may do this earlier if they need to. A valid ID, proof of address, and, if needed, proof of ownership of a payment method are common types of documents. If you are asked to verify your account, send in clear, up-to-date documents right away so that your account can stay active. Important: if the casino needs to be sure where the £100 or more came from, they may need to take extra steps to make sure.

This could mean asking for proof of payment in the form of screenshots, bank statements, or other papers. The account holder needs to fully cooperate because not responding to verification requests can slow down withdrawals or limit how £50 deposits can be used.

  • Use your own legal name and contact information when you sign up.
  • Only use one account, and don't make multiple profiles.
  • If asked, be ready to show proof of ID, address, and payment.
  • Verify that documents can be read and match the information in your account.
  • Quickly finish verification to avoid delays or account limits on withdrawals.

Wagering Requirements, Game Limits, And Bonus Abuse Rules

Most LeoVegas casino bonuses come with clear wagering requirements that spell out how much you need to bet before you can cash out any bonus winnings.

In practice, this means that you have to bet a certain number of times the bonus amount or sometimes the bonus plus deposit. Check the requirement before you accept any offer. If you're playing with £, make sure you have enough money to last the whole game without rushing into bets with a higher risk. Limits on games are also important. Some games may not count at all or count less than others when it comes to wagering. Because your contribution rate can change how quickly you clear a bonus, this is especially important if you like slots, live dealer games, or table games.

LeoVegas may also set limits on the biggest bet you can make while you have a bonus. If you go over those limits, you could lose your bonus winnings. The rules for bonus abuse are the same at LeoVegas as they are at most regulated casinos. Making multiple accounts, taking advantage of mistakes in promotions, betting in ways that aren't allowed, or trying to cash out bonus funds before meeting the wagering requirements are all common examples. It's easy to stay safe: just use one account, follow the offer's rules to the letter, and don't bet more than what's allowed. Before you claim any bonus, make sure you meet the wagering requirements. This is especially important if you plan to deposit £50 or more.

To make sure your play counts toward the requirement, check to see which games are eligible. During bonus play, stick to the maximum bet limit so you don't lose prizes. Do not use linked or duplicate accounts, as this could be seen as abuse. Read the rules for withdrawal carefully, because you might not be able to cash out some bonus winnings until you've met all the wagering requirements.
